Constance Depler Coleman
Portrait Artist


Humor, forlornness, languorous stretches and leaping delight are all depicted in Constance Depler Coleman's portrait paintings. One of America's premier animal portraitists, she is unique in her rendering of her subjects in their home settings. Her lifestyle portraits have brought her subjects' personality and history to life for clients all over the United States and Canada.


While she can work from clients' photographs, she prefers to spend time with her subjects in person where she can get to know their special quirks and graces as well as their forms. At that time she and the client can work out details, location, background, size and cost of the painting.


Later in her studio, she studies the rolls of film she has shot. By juxtaposing her subjects in their favorite spots or perhaps on a couch, an Oriental rug, or even in the back of a pickup truck, she creates the lifestyle compositions so treasured by her clients.


Constance Depler Coleman studied at the California School of Fine Arts and at the University of Southern California. She has had special exhibitions in New York, Dallas, Washington, D.C., Toronto and Palm Beach, among other places. She has been the subject of many feature articles in over two dozen newspapers and magazines, ranging from the Los Angeles Times to the AKC Dog Museum News. She has also been featured on TV programs such as Disney Cable Epcot Magazine and the Mac & Mutley Show.
